引言
编程技能在当今社会的重要性不言而喻,无论是从事技术行业还是日常生活中的数据处理,编程能力都已成为一项基本技能。对于编程初学者来说,选择合适的入门工具至关重要。本文将介绍几款免费APP,帮助大家轻松入门程序设计语言。
一、Scratch
1. 简介
Scratch是一款由麻省理工学院开发的教育性编程语言,旨在帮助孩子们学习编程基础。它采用图形化编程界面,通过拖拽积木块的方式实现代码编写。
2. 功能
- 图形化编程:简化编程过程,降低学习门槛。
- 模块化设计:方便理解和记忆编程逻辑。
- 项目分享:用户可以上传和分享自己的作品。
3. 下载与安装
- iOS设备:在App Store搜索“Scratch”下载。
- Android设备:在Google Play搜索“Scratch”下载。
二、Code.org
1. 简介
Code.org是一个非营利组织,致力于推广编程教育。该APP提供了一系列编程课程,适合不同年龄段的用户。
2. 功能
- 编程课程:涵盖基础语法、算法、数据结构等内容。
- 挑战任务:通过解决实际问题提升编程能力。
- 教师资源:为教师提供教学支持和资源。
3. 下载与安装
- iOS设备:在App Store搜索“Code.org”下载。
- Android设备:在Google Play搜索“Code.org”下载。
三、Tynker
1. 简介
Tynker是一款针对青少年的编程教育APP,采用图形化编程界面,帮助用户学习Python、JavaScript等编程语言。
2. 功能
- 图形化编程:简化编程过程,降低学习门槛。
- 实时反馈:用户在编写代码时,系统会实时显示运行结果。
- 项目分享:用户可以上传和分享自己的作品。
3. 下载与安装
- iOS设备:在App Store搜索“Tynker”下载。
- Android设备:在Google Play搜索“Tynker”下载。
四、Pydroid 3
1. 简介
Pydroid 3是一款基于Python的编程APP,支持多种编程语言,适合有一定编程基础的初学者。
2. 功能
- 支持多种编程语言:Python、Java、C/C++等。
- 代码编辑器:提供代码高亮、自动补全等功能。
- 模拟器:可以在APP内运行代码。
3. 下载与安装
- iOS设备:在App Store搜索“Pydroid 3”下载。
- Android设备:在Google Play搜索“Pydroid 3”下载。
总结
以上几款免费APP可以帮助用户轻松入门程序设计语言。在实际学习过程中,建议用户根据自己的兴趣和需求选择合适的APP,并结合实际项目进行实践,不断提高编程能力。
